Shop drawing scale

When a shop drawing is produced it has a scale that is controlled by the style manager. I want to know how I can find out that scale without going through the "detail drawing properties" and reading it of the dialogue box. In other words I would like to know if there is a command that will show the scale on the command line.

You can add the SCALE token into the title block and this will automatically show the scale of the detail.  I don't believe there is a way to show it on the command line, but this works if you don't mind the scale showing on the drawing.
